The life cylce of ''S. papillosus'' is typical of [[:Category:Rhabditoidea|strongyloides]] species with both parasitic and free living cycles. As adults animals will become immune to infection the primary method of infection for young animals is through the milk of the dam, this still involves only females as males are only present in the environment as 'free-living' nematodes.
